Don't know about the setup differences but Alonso is braking earlier than Stroll into most of the corners. In FP1 he was having to use the left toggle to get the braking into turn 3 for it to work. I didn't hear problems about that in FP2.

On the 2nd hot lap in FP2, when he came into the pits and sat ...He asked for more front wing....They didn't say how much publicly.
